如何使用包含对象的数组并根据对象的属性检查对象?

任务是检查数组是否包含特定值。另外,我们需要检查数组是否包含具有给定属性的特定对象。使用array.includes()方法检查数组中是否存在值array.includes()方法允许我们检查数组是否包含任何值。简单来说,我们可以...

JavaScript 中的国际化是如何工作的?

在本文中,您将了解JavaScript中国际化的工作原理。国际化是准备软件以支持当地语言和文化环境的过程。它可以包括更改日期和时间格式、更改公制格式、语言格式等。示例1在这个例子中,我们来了解一下日期和时间格式...

如何使用FabricJS设置文本转换的垂直原点?

在本教程中,我们将学习如何使用FabricJS设置文本转换的垂直原点。我们可以通过添加Fabric.Text的实例在画布上显示文本。它不仅允许我们移动、缩放和更改文本的尺寸,而且还提供了附加功能,例如文本对齐、文本装饰、...

用于在不交换数据的情况下交换链表中的节点的 JavaScript 程序

在不交换数据的情况下交换链表中的节点的JavaScript程序是Web开发中的一个常见问题,涉及重新排列链表中的节点顺序。链表是一种由节点组成的数据结构,每个节点包含一条数据和对列表中下一个节点的引用。在本文中,我...

如何使用 FabricJS 禁用 IText 的选择性?

在本教程中,我们将学习如何使用FabricJS禁用IText的选择性。IText类是在FabricJS版本1.4中引入的,它扩展了Fabric.Text并用于创建IText实例。IText实例使我们可以自由选择、剪切、粘贴或添加新文本,而无...

FabricJS – 如何禁用 Line 对象的多个特定控制点?

在本教程中,我们将学习如何使用FabricJS禁用Line对象的多个特定控制点。Line元素是FabricJS中提供的基本元素之一。它用于创建直线。由于线元素在几何上是一维的并且不包含内部,因此它们永远不会被填充。我们可...

如何在 JavaScript 中获取第一个非空/未定义参数?

在JavaScript中,很多时候我们需要在函数中查找第一个非null/未定义的参数。这可能是一项棘手的任务,但幸运的是,有一些方法可以帮助我们完成此任务使用Array.prototype.find()一个方法可用于获取JavaScript中的第一...

JavaScript 与 Core Java:哪个更好?

很难说JavaScript和CoreJava哪个“更好”,因为它们是两种不同的编程语言,具有不同的用例和优势。JavaScriptJavaScript是一种流行且广泛使用的Web开发语言。它用于创建交互式网页,并受到所有现代网络浏览器的...

如何使用 HTML、CSS 和 JavaScript 构建随机报价生成器?

在本教程中,我们将使用HTML、CSS和JavaScript构建一个项目,该项目将从API(type.fit)生成随机引用。步骤<p>我们将遵循一些基本步骤-创建HTML元素和模板使用添加样式CSSJavaScript逻辑创建HTML元素和模板...

如何使用FabricJS锁定Triangle的垂直缩放?

在本教程中,我们将学习如何使用FabricJS锁定三角形的垂直缩放。正如我们可以指定画布中三角形对象的位置、颜色、不透明度和尺寸一样,我们也可以指定是否要停止垂直缩放对象。这可以通过使用lockScalingY属性来完成...

如何使用 FabricJS 查找 Image 实例的复杂度?

在本教程中,我们将学习如何查找Image实例的复杂度使用FabricJS。我们可以通过创建fabric.Image的实例来创建一个Image对象。由于它是FabricJS的基本元素之一,我们也可以轻松地自定义它应用角度、不透明度等属性。...

如何在 React Native 中显示加载指示器?

当我们想要告诉用户他们在UI上发出的请求需要时间时,请使用加载指示器。如果用户在填写表单后单击了提交按钮,或者单击了搜索按钮来获取一些数据。ReactNative提供了一个ActivityIndi​​cator组件,它可以通过不同...

如何使用FabricJS禁用矩形的居中缩放?

在本教程中,我们将学习如何使用FabricJS禁用矩形的居中缩放。矩形是FabricJS提供的各种形状之一。为了创建一个矩形,我们需要创建一个fabric.Rect类的实例,并将其添加到画布上。当通过控制器进行缩放时,将centeredScaling...

如何自动测试 JavaScript 代码?

测试JavaScript代码的自动化可以帮助我们确保我们的代码按照预期工作,并捕捉其中包含的任何错误或bug。在本文中,您将了解如何自动化测试JavaScript代码。有几种可以在JavaScript上执行的测试。单元测试在这个测试中...

JavaScript 中的闭包是如何工作的?

在本文中,我们将了解“闭包”以及它们在JavaScript中的实际工作原理。闭包基本上是一个函数的组合,该函数包含对其周围状态的引用(也称为词法环境)。在JavaScript中,基本上每次在运行时创建函数时都会创建闭包。换句话...

如何在 JavaScript 中比较两个对象以确定第一个对象是否包含与第二个对象相同的属性值?

在JavaScript中,对象包含各种属性和方法。对于每个属性,它都包含一个值。我们还需要比较属性的值来进行两个对象之间的比较。在这里,我们将学习检查第一个对象是否包含第二个对象包含的所有属性,并比较每个属性的值。...

在 Node.js 中创建代理

您可以使用newAgent()方法在Node.js中创建代理实例。http.request()方法使用“http”模块中的globalAgent创建自定义http.Agent实例。语法newAgent({options})参数上述函数可以接受以下参数−选项</stro...

使用 JavaScript 验证密码

在当今的数字环境中,强大的密码验证的重要性怎么强调都不为过,在线安全是最重要的问题。确保用户密码满足某些标准(例如复杂性和长度要求)对于保护敏感信息免遭未经授权的访问至关重要。JavaScript是一种多功能脚本语言...

如何使用 JavaScript 检查单选按钮是否被选中?

在HTML中,单选按钮允许开发人员为选择创建多个选项。用户可以选择任意一个选项,我们可以获取其值并了解用户在多个选项中选择了哪个选项。因此,检查用户选择哪个单选按钮以了解他们从多个选项中做出的选择非常重要。...

如何在JavaScript中将字符串转换为整数而不使用parseInt()函数?

parseInt()是JavaScript中的一个内置函数,用于解析字符串并返回一个整数。然而,有时我们想要将一个字符串转换为整数,而不使用这个函数。在本文中,我们将探讨如何做到这一点。使用一元加号运算符将字符串转换为整数的...

如何使用 FabricJS 设置三角形的最小允许比例值?

在本教程中,我们将学习如何使用FabricJS设置三角形允许的最小比例。三角形是FabricJS提供的各种形状之一。为了创建一个三角形,我们必须创建一个Fabric.Triangle类的实例并将其添加到画布中。我们可以通过添加填...

将矩阵向右旋转 K 次的 JavaScript 程序

术语“对矩阵进行右旋转”是指将矩阵中的每一列向右移动。如果指定,此操作将重复“k”次。换句话说,它是发生“k”次的矩阵右移。该程序可以使用各种编程语言来实现,但一个简单而有效的方法是考虑使用JavaScript将矩阵...

如何借助 JavaScript 创建具有随机值的数组?

我们可以使用JavaScriptMath.random()方法来生成随机值。JavaScript为我们提供了不同的数组方法,例如from()、fill()和Push(),可用于创建具有随机值的数组。JavaScript中的数组是一项强大的功能,可让您存储不...

如何使用 FabricJS 设置文本中的动画持续时间?

在本教程中,我们将学习如何使用FabricJS设置动画文本的持续时间。我们可以通过添加Fabric.Text的实例在画布上显示文本。它不仅允许我们移动、缩放和更改文本的尺寸,而且还提供了附加功能,例如文本对齐、文本装饰、...

如何在 JavaScript 中通过连接数组的元素来创建字符串?

在本教程中,我们将了解如何通过在JavaScript中连接数组的元素来创建字符串。我们将看到两种不同的方法来完成这项任务。第一种方法是使用简单的加法运算符(+)来添加数组元素和分隔符。第二种方法是使用join()方...